WebAccording to the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O), patent illustrations should be submitted on white matte paper that is flexible and strong and should be: Single sided. Either 21cm by 29.7cm or 21.6cm by 27.9 cm (8 1/2 by 11 inches) Margined as follows. 2.5 cm on the top. 2.5 cm on the left side. Homeowners insurance claims typically stay on a national property claim database called the Comprehensive Loss Underwriting Exchange (CLUE) for five to seven years.
